How do you encrypt CSS?

How to secure CSS file?

You can place either JavaScript or CSS files in your secured server and read those files using JavaScript obfuscated code to prevent the unnecessary access. Remove all your CSS and JavaScript files from the solution which needs security and place those files in the secured server.

Can you obfuscate CSS?

What it does: – It will take your CSS file, apply minification, encoding and encypting and finally injects this unreadable crap into tailored JS library (also obfuscated). – The result you will get is this tailored (unique) library, containing obfuscated CSS. Just include it in the place of the original CSS.

Can you encrypt JavaScript?

You can obfuscate it, but there’s no way of protecting it completely. No, it’s not possible. If it runs on the client browser, it must be downloaded by the client browser. It’s pretty trivial to use Fiddler to inspect the HTTP session and get any downloaded js files.

What is CSS injection?

A CSS Injection vulnerability involves the ability to inject arbitrary CSS code in the context of a trusted web site which is rendered inside a victim’s browser. … This vulnerability occurs when the application allows user-supplied CSS to interfere with the application’s legitimate stylesheets.

THIS IS INTERESTING:  Question: What are optional subjects in CSS?

How do I restrict JavaScript download?

Sadly there isn’t a definite way to stop people downloading the JS files, CSS files or image files from your website as these are executed within the browser, the best you can do is to try and minify or obfuscate the files in such a way that they become near impossible to read and therefore use or copy.

Can you obfuscate HTML?

To obfuscate an HTML code page means to encrypt or hide strings of characters which are likely email addresses and other source code within the code page. When HTML is obfuscated, spam robots are not able to glean email addresses from the code. … The encoder application installs a handler for HTML output for PHP pages.

How do you obfuscate JavaScript?

Obfuscation: Transform your code to make it hard to steal or copy. A JavaScript Obfuscator will transform your entire source code to make it virtually impossible to read and understand. While the process may modify actual method instructions or metadata, it does not alter the functionality of the program.

Does Facebook obfuscate code?

The methods Facebook uses to thwart ad-blocking technology have been criticised by web developers. … It would be easy for a plug-in to spot the word “sponsored” or to find a container labelled “ad” inside the webpage code, so companies, including Facebook, use coding tricks to obfuscate their ads.

How do I encrypt my source code?

The “View Source” is showing the HTML source—if you encrypt that, the user (and the browser) won’t be able to read your content anymore. If you want to protect your PHP source, then there are tools like Zend Guard. It would encrypt your source code and make it hard to reverse engineer.

THIS IS INTERESTING:  How do you rotate text in css3?

What is the best Javascript Obfuscator?

10 Best Node. js Obfuscation Libraries

  • javascript-obfuscator. Save. A powerful obfuscator for JavaScript and Node.js. …
  • gni. gnirts. Save. …
  • obfuscator-loader. Save. A webpack loader for obfuscating single modules using javascript-obfuscator. …
  • gjo. grunt-javascript-obfuscator. Save. …
  • jo. js-obfuscator. …
  • baf. baffle. …
  • obf. obfuscator. …
  • jfo. jfogs.

How do you obfuscate code?

Some common obfuscation techniques include the following:

  1. Renaming. The obfuscator alters the methods and names of variables. …
  2. Packing. …
  3. Control flow. …
  4. Instruction pattern transformation. …
  5. Dummy code insertion. …
  6. Metadata or unused code removal. …
  7. Opaque predicate insertion. …
  8. Anti-debug.

What is the difference between XSS and CSRF?

What is the difference between XSS and CSRF? Cross-site scripting (or XSS) allows an attacker to execute arbitrary JavaScript within the browser of a victim user. Cross-site request forgery (or CSRF) allows an attacker to induce a victim user to perform actions that they do not intend to.

Website creation and design